I'll share more later, but for now, let's talk about this week's Freebie! How do you like my little pumpkin? He's completely made out of punches and dies. The "body core" is made out of the Fancy Favor box and his "body exterior" is made out of the Clear Circle Big Shot die (3 circles for the front and 3 for the back). His face is from the photo corners punch and his stem is from the designer label punch. Isn't he a cutie? Here's a look at him from the side view: I used the jumbo eyelets to reinforce the handle. This is a great Halloween project and lots of fun to make, too!
